Figma vs v0 by Vercel: Which Is Better in 2026?

Figma and v0 by Vercel are both design tools, but they're built around different workflows. Figma focuses on design teams creating ui/ux and digital products, and is used primarily by ux designer. v0 by Vercel is designed for developers prototyping ui components, catering to frontend developer. Workflow Fit

Figma workflow: Create designs → Collaborate in real-time → Prototype → Handoff to dev

v0 by Vercel workflow: Describe UI → AI generates → Copy code → Use in project

Figma vs v0 by Vercel: Deep Dive

Figma logo

Figma

Collaborative interface design tool

Figma is a cloud-based design tool for UI/UX with AI features like auto-layout, design suggestions, and developer handoff. It enables real-time collaboration for design teams.

v0 by Vercel logo

v0 by Vercel

Generate UI with simple text prompts

v0 is a generative UI system by Vercel that creates React components from text prompts using AI.
